Have you seen this Korean performance of ‘Phule Phule Dhole Dhole’?

Shared by Instagram account @lunayogini, the video is sure to take you back to your school dance performances

Published 08.05.24, 09:13 AM
Image courtesy: @lunayogini/Instagram

Do you remember being in school, and in the lead up to Rabindra Jayanti celebrations, heading to dance or music rehearsals? Inevitably, one of the songs to feature in the line-up — especially when you were a pre-primary or primary school kid — would be Phule Phule Dhole Dhole. My Kolkata just stumbled upon a video on Instagram that will unlock that core memory. Dasom Her, a content creator and author of the book Be You, who often shares content on her love for India and for all things Bangla, recently shared a reel of a Korean band called GRΛNΛDΛ performing the popular Rabindrasangeet, at what seems to be a cultural programme. The mellow rendition with primarily Western classical instruments adds a contemporary flair to the much-loved melody, while keeping all the nostalgia. 

Not only were we overjoyed to see the young Korean performers singing a song that is close to every Bengali’s hearts, but also impressed to see how diverse backgrounds have appreciation for our culture.
